Abstract

The invention provides a shading switching device which is applied to a digital pathological section scanner. The digital pathological section scanner comprises an objective lens and a collecting lens, and the shading switching device comprises a shading plate arranged between the objective lens and the collecting lens; and a sliding device which is connected with the light shielding plate, so that the light shielding plate can controllably move between a first position between the objective lens and the condenser lens and a second position between the objective lens and the condenser lens, and when the light shielding plate is located at the first position, shielding is formed between the objective lens and the condenser lens. The invention has the beneficial effects that installation is convenient, the structure is simple, the space utilization rate is high, and automation and intellectualization of light source shielding switching of the collecting lens can be achieved through the light shielding switching device.

Description

technical field [0001] The invention relates to the technical field of optical scanning, in particular to a light-shielding switching device and a digital pathological slice scanner. Background technique [0002] Pathological section is to solidify the diseased tissue or internal organs of the human body by burying, cut into thin slices with a microtome, and then adhere to the glass slide for staining, and present it on the display screen through a microscope and scanner, which is convenient for doctors to observe patients pathological changes, make a pathological diagnosis, and provide assistance for clinical diagnosis and treatment. [0003] Under the prior art, scanning of pathological slices is often disturbed by light generated by the condenser, and observers often use a shield to cover the condenser to block the light source.
